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ons Coming to Nintendo Switch With Co-op Mode

Spread the love

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ons will be available for Nintendo Switch on May 28. The Switch version gets a new mode where two players work together. The game first appeared in 2013 and originally only has a single player mode.

The adventure game revolves around two brothers who search for a cure for their father’s mysterious ailment. The game stood out in 2013 because of the way the player had to control two characters with one controller.

The Switch version includes a co-op mode for the first time, in which two players can play at the same time and each can control a character. The ability to play together makes the game easier by allowing players to focus on only one character. The Switch version can also be played in the original way.

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ons was created by Josef Fares, who was later also responsible for prison break game A Way Out. The game first came out in 2013 for the Xbox 360 and later versions for the PlayStation 3 and PC followed. The game has also been released for the PlayStation 4, Xbox One, Android, iOS and Windows Phone in recent years.

Publisher 505 Games is releasing the Switch version of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ons digitally only. The game is available on the Nintendo eShop for $15.
